#ee1629 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ee1629 is composed of 93.3% red, 8.6%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 82.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 354.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 51%. #ee1629 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c52 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ee1629 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ee1629 has RGB values of R:238, G:22,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.83,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15603241.

Shades and Tints of #ee1629

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fef1f2 is the lightest one.
